What is the difference between Part 121 and Part 135?
WebWhat is the difference between FAR Part 121 and 135? Part 121 deals with commercial air service, flights that are scheduled, and have paying passengers, i.e. customers. Part 135 regulates the on-demand flights and scheduled charter flights. Scheduled charter flights are usually limited to a few days a week.
